Step into a world where the rhythmic waves of the ocean meet the timeless artistry of Indian heritage with our Blue and Off-White Tie-Dyed and Printed Silk Saree. This exquisite piece is a masterclass in the ancient craft of resist-dyeing, a technique that traces its roots back centuries to the vibrant landscapes of Rajasthan and Gujarat. The saree is crafted from the finest silk, offering a lustrous sheen that catches the light with every movement, creating a fluid silhouette that drapes elegantly over the form. The deep azure base is punctuated by striking horizontal tie-dyed bands in a pristine off-white, reminiscent of the ‘Leheriya’ or wave pattern, symbolizing prosperity and the flow of life. The pallu is further elevated with intricate block-printed floral motifs, providing a sophisticated contrast to the bold geometry of the body.
